The Rise of Responsible Gambling Tools: A Data-Driven Perspective

The global online gambling market is projected to reach a value of over USD 100 billion by 2026, according to industry analysts. However, this growth underscores the urgent need for effective harm minimization strategies. Recent studies indicate that approximately 1-3% of gambling populations develop problematic behaviors, yet the implementation of responsible betting technologies can significantly reduce these figures.

Technology Functionality Impact on User Safety
Reality Checks Periodic prompts reminding players of session duration Helps prevent excessive gambling sessions
Deposit Limits Allows users to set daily, weekly, or monthly caps Reduces financial harm from impulsive betting
Self-Exclusion Enables players to ban themselves temporarily or permanently Provides control and prevention of problematic behavior
AI-Driven Monitoring Real-time analysis of betting patterns to identify risk Facilitates early intervention and support

Technical Innovations Promoting Safe Gambling Habits

Emerging technologies like art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and biometric verification are transforming responsible betting practices. For example, AI algorithms analyze betting activity in real-time to identify red flags such as rapid deposits, irregular betting patterns, or sustained sessions beyond typical limits.

Regulatory Landscape and Compliance Expectations

Regulators across the United Kingdom and Europe increasingly mandate responsible betting tools as standard features, emphasizing transparency and user protection. The UK Gambling Commission, for instance, requires licensees to implement effective harm minimization strategies, including real-time monitoring and user self-regulation options.

Operators proactive in adopting these tools not only comply but also demonstrate leadership and corporate responsibility—buildings trust within their consumer base and regulators alike.
